CAS 80890-07-9
:ethyl methyl (4R)-2,6-dimethyl-4-(3-nitrophenyl)-1,4-dihydropyridine-3,5-dicarboxylate
Description:
Ethyl methyl (4R)-2,6-dimethyl-4-(3-nitrophenyl)-1,4-dihydropyridine-3,5-dicarboxylate, with the CAS number 80890-07-9, is a synthetic organic compound belonging to the class of dihydropyridines, which are known for their diverse biological activities. This compound features a dihydropyridine core, characterized by a six-membered ring containing nitrogen, and is substituted with various functional groups, including ethyl and methyl esters, as well as a nitrophenyl moiety. The presence of the nitro group contributes to its potential reactivity and biological properties. Dihydropyridines are often studied for their role as calcium channel blockers and in the development of pharmaceuticals. The specific stereochemistry indicated by the (4R) designation suggests that the compound has a defined spatial arrangement, which can significantly influence its biological activity and interactions. Overall, this compound's unique structure and functional groups make it a subject of interest in medicinal chemistry and pharmacology.
